A young girl who cried hysterically after learning President Obama would be leaving the White House in January took a special trip to meet him in person.
Caprina Harris posted the video to Facebook last month. It shows her granddaughter, 1st grader Kameria Crayton, crying inconsolably, not wanting Obama to leave office

The clip has been shared more than 10,000 times.
Kameria wrote a letter to the president, saying she didn’t want him to leave, and she wanted to meet him at the White House.
Kameria traveled to Washington from Birmingham, Alabama, to make it happen.
Kameria and her family met the Obama and First Lady Michelle Sunday during the White House Easter Egg Roll.
